Interpret circuit diagrams with parallel resistors; Resistors are in parallel when each resistor is connected directly to the voltage source by connecting wires having negligible resistance. Each resistor thus has the full voltage of the source applied to it. Resistors are in parallel when one end of all the resistors are connected by a continuous wire.
